TRASH FOR CASH
FUNDRAISING OPPORTUNITY FOR NON-PROFIT GROUPS ONLY "TRASH FOR CASH" is a program which allows non-profit groups the opportunity to raise money by collecting litter along roadsides. Approved applicants can receive $75 per centerline mile of county roads cleaned. Group must be located in Meade County. Call or come by the office for more information: Meade County Solid Waste & Recycle 750 Ready Mix Rd Brandenburg, KY 40108 270-422-2868
